About the role

Overview:

  • Workstyle: Remote

  • Reports to: Director of Revenue Operations Excellence 

  • Travel Expectations:  Minimal travel; will be determined by business needs and may include occasional trips for key meetings, collaboration opportunities, or area-connected events.

What we’re looking for: 

We’re seeking a highly organized, strategic-minded, and collaborative Senior Project Manager to lead the transformation of Custom Ink’s Revenue team. The ideal candidate excels at managing complex initiatives from ideation through execution, facilitating alignment across cross-functional stakeholders, and maintaining clear visibility into priorities and progress.

  • 6+ years of experience in project/program management, strategic operations, or business transformation

  • Strong experience creating centralized project tracking and backlog management systems

  • Proficiency in project management tools (e.g., Asana, Smartsheet, Jira) and familiarity with Agile or hybrid methodologies

  • Strong communication and stakeholder engagement skills, with the ability to influence without authority

  • Experience organizing cross-functional initiatives with high visibility and impact

  • Proven ability to manage scope, timelines, and resource allocation across a portfolio of initiatives

  • A bias for action and a growth mindset with a knack for connecting strategy to execution

What you’ll do: 

  • Lead the transformation program for the Revenue team, building a centralized backlog of initiatives that align with business priorities

  • Own the intake, scoping, and organization of new strategic initiatives, ensuring clarity of goals, ownership, and alignment

  • Establish and maintain a centralized dashboard of all active and planned initiatives, including owners, stakeholders, status, and timelines

  • Facilitate ideation, planning, and prioritization sessions across revenue teams to translate vision into actionable projects

  • Partner with functional leaders to define initiative success criteria, track progress, and proactively identify risks or blockers

  • Maintain initiative hygiene by clearly distinguishing active projects from backlog and archiving completed or deprioritized efforts

  • Support leadership in quarterly and monthly planning routines with up-to-date views of project health and portfolio impact

How you’ll be measured:

  • Accuracy, clarity, and accessibility of centralized initiative tracking

  • Adoption and usage of standardized project intake, planning, and reporting processes

  • Improved cross-functional alignment and visibility into Revenue transformation efforts

  • Timely execution of prioritized initiatives

  • Positive feedback from internal stakeholders and business partners

How you’ll make a difference: 

As Senior Project Manager, Revenue Transformation, you’ll bring clarity, structure, and momentum to some of Custom Ink’s most critical strategic efforts. You’ll drive operational excellence by organizing and advancing a portfolio of transformative initiatives that enable the Revenue team to execute with focus and agility. Through strong collaboration and sharp project leadership, you’ll help create a more connected and effective way of working across teams.

Compensation:

We are committed to providing pay transparency and equitable compensation.

  • For this salaried, exempt position, the base salary range is $90,000 - $128,000. Placement within the range is determined by a variety of factors, including but not limited to: knowledge, skills, years & depth of experience, and equity with internal team members.
